National Minimum wage in 2022

Is the UK’s national minimum wage going up in 2022?

Yes!

The national minimum wage is going up in 2022 on 1st April – as announced by Rishi Sunak in October 2021 as part of his budget.

23 and over = £9.50

21 to 22 = £9.18

18 to 20 = £6.83

Under 18 = £4.81

Budget reveals 50% business rates discount and 'draught relief'

Chancellor Rishi Sunak has offered the hospitality sector a 50% discount on business rates for the next year.

He will also introduce “draught relief” which will apply a new lower rate of duty on draught beer and cider. It will particularly benefit community pubs who do 75% of their trade on...

VAT changes to hospitality - September 2021

You most probably are aware of the reduction to 5% of specific VAT supplies in the hospitality industry, which the Chancellor introduced on 8th July 2020 to help the sector through COVID.

The Chancellor then extended the 5% VAT until the end of September 2021.
